Even if you are an Android user, you know the look of a standard iPhone. Sure, there are some changes, but in the last few generations, Apple hasn’t done anything completely with the design of the phone – so much that most people aren’t necessarily able to tell you if you have the latest version of its flagship.

I don’t know you, but when I patted my new device, the first time I thought of it was: “I want to touch it.” I’ve been writing about iPhones for over a decade and I don’t remember the last time it was.

For most lengths, the air thickness is only 5.6mm. This attractive slim profile is only further enhanced by the gloss effect. If you are one of the first to get in touch with this phone, you can guarantee that it will attract everyone nearby, and this approach often doesn’t happen with Tech in 2025.

This is not always the case. When I grew up, I often couldn’t afford the most advanced or expensive phones, so I would search for weird ones. Some favorites include the Navy Blue Sony Ericsson Z200 with a round orange screen in front and a tiny tiny SAGEM MW 3020. These phones are the beginning of the conversation – usually when I whip them out of the inner bag of my school coat, it’s the first time people see them.

Unless you have a foldable phone, it rarely happens these days. But I predict that the iPhone Air could become a real stealing scenario – at least at first. Note that people will want to hold it, touch it and pretend to be joking to bend or discard it, so if you are precious about other people’s filthy paws on your technology, keep it in your pocket. But if you uncover it in front of friends, you might envy all of this.
